Transaction 4708d5f2faccaee83643b2599638415292233a2b58e376928569b23993220ecc

2 Input
2 Outputs
  • 4708d5f2faccaee83643b2599638415292233a2b58e376928569b23993220ecc:0
  • value  575612219
    address  15eJeQt2z7Va536a1U7mGGDofXDU51Kjvc
  • 4708d5f2faccaee83643b2599638415292233a2b58e376928569b23993220ecc:1
  • value  626683708
    address  1H1WS2tFx5yCsxtefs9PSTdqVX2mduyf3b